The Dream
"I saw myself walking through a garden of golden olive trees, and a calm river ran beside me. Birds sang from every branch."
Insight
Olive trees in Ibn Sirin's tradition signify a blessed, righteous person or sustained provision (Quran 24:35). Calm running water often points to knowledge or rizq arriving with ease. Singing birds carry good news, especially from absent loved ones. Together, this reads as a possible ruya: a season of blessing and clear guidance is approaching.
وَاللَّهُ أَعْلَم — And Allah knows best.
